![]() The investigation and treatment of yaws and syphilis was heralded as one of the great triumphs of the US occupation of Haiti, which lasted from 1915 to 1934. Robert Parsons’ History of Haitian medicine, the anti-treponematoses campaigns took centre stage in a text issued solely to bask in the achievements of US imperial medicine in Haiti.
